4.392 rept-stat-alm

Use this command to provide status of all alarms.

Parameters

clli (optional)
CLLI string. Displays only alarms that pertain to a particular CLLI.
Range:
ayyyyyyyyyy
dev (optional)
Device. The type of device for which alarms are displayed.
Range:
applsock
as
card
cdt
clock
dlk
ls
lsmsconn
route
slk
trm
rtx
e1port
t1port
tps
enet
display (optional)
Type of alarms to be displayed. When the display=inhb parameter is specified, the Alarm Inhibit Report appears in the command output and provides information about inhibited alarms in the system. The dev parameter can be specified with this parameter to display the Alarm Inhibit Report for a specific device type.
Range:
inhb
dur (optional)
Duration. This parameter indicates whether to display permanently inhibited alarms, temporarily inhibited alarms, or timed inhibited alarms. This parameter is valid only when the display=inhb parameter is specified.
Range:
perm
temp
timed
edate (optional)
Expiry date. This parameter allows the user to see timed alarm inhibits that will expire on the specified date.
Range:
101 - 991231

Specify the date in the format year, followed by month, followed by day.

Example

rept-stat-alm

rept-stat-alm:display=inhb:dev=card

rept-stat-alm:display=inhb:clli=slkset1:dev=ls

rept-stat-alm:display=inhb

rept-stat-alm:display=inhb:dur=timed

rept-stat-alm:display=inhb:dur=timed:edate=040520

Dependencies

No other rept-stat-xxx command can be in progress when this command is entered.

The dur parameter can be specified only if the display=inhb parameter is specified.

The dur, dev, or clli parameter can be specified only if the display=inhb parameter is specified.

The edate parameter can be specified only if the dur=timed parameter is specified.

The dev parameter can have only the values slk, ls, or route if the clli parameter is specified.

The dur parameter must be compatible with the specified device.

The value specified for the clli parameter must already exist in the DSTN table.

The value specified for the edate parameter must be greater than the system date.

Legend

  • ALARM TRANSFER—The destination of the alarms. LMC=Local Maintenance Center, RMC=Remote Maintenance Center.
  • ALARM MODE—Displays whether the critical, major, and minor alarms are silent or audible
  • ALARM FRAME 1—Number of critical, major, and minor alarms detected in the control frame CF-00 (frame 1)
  • ALARM FRAME 2—Number of critical, major, and minor alarms detected in extension frame EF-00 (frame 2)
  • ALARM FRAME 3—Number of critical, major, and minor alarms detected in extension frame EF-01 (frame 3)
  • ALARM FRAME 4—Number of critical, major, and minor alarms detected in extension frame EF-02 (frame 4)
  • ALARM FRAME 5—Number of critical, major, and minor alarms detected in extension frame EF-03 (frame 5)
  • ALARM FRAME 6—Number of critical, major, and minor alarms detected in extension frame EF-04 (frame 6) and all the miscellaneous OAP alarms.

  • PERM. INH. ALARMS—Number of alarms that are permanently inhibited per alarm level
  • TEMP. INH. ALARMS—Number of alarms that are temporarily inhibited per alarm level
  • TIMED. INH. ALARMS—Number of alarms that are timed inhibited per alarm level
  • ACTIVE ALARMS—Number of alarms still active per alarm level.
  • TOTAL ALARMS—Total number of alarms per alarm level. The inhibited alarm count plus the active alarm count equals the total alarm count.
  • CRIT—Critical alarms with silent/audible indicator
  • MAJOR—Major alarms with silent/audible indicator
  • MINOR—Minor alarms with silent/audible indicator

Alarm Inhibit Report:

  • DEVICE—Device for which alarms are currently inhibited. Only devices that are alarm inhibited are shown.
  • ELEMENT—Element of the device for which alarms are inhibited (such as card location, port, routing key, socket or association name)
  • DURATION—Indicates whether the device is alarm inhibited permanently or temporarily or for a specific length of time 
  • INH LVL—Level in which devices are alarm inhibited (Critical, Major, Minor). The inh-alm command defaults the level to Major. Devices cannot be alarm inhibited at a critical level unless the chg-stpopts command's critalminh parameter is turned on.
  • ALM LVL—Level of the current alarm on the device (Critical, Major, Minor). "None" indicates that there is currently no alarm on the device (DURATION should show "PERM"). A plus sign (+) seen following the alarm level indicates that the current alarm is not inhibited because the level of the inhibit is less than the level of the alarm.
  • DATE—Date on which a timed inhibited alarm will automatically clear at the specified time
  • TIME—Time at which a timed inhibited alarm will automatically clear on the specified date
